Tarot


a game of patience 1937 by meredith frampton

shuffle the deck
slip slide down
within a salt scattered circle
carefully placed bloodstone
then tigers eye
set the tone
through the air of stale smoke
embassy blue
and crunching mints
my future turns
and tilts
with the emperor
the fool and the three of cups
daylight fades to shimmer
the knave of wands and temperance arrive
i throw the salt over my shoulder
before the devil and the ten of swords
gatecrash the pack
darkness descends to a single candle
i shun the tower and hermit
rose and geranium filter through the window
willingly i embrace the moon and stars
my patience rewarded.

Alice on the walls.


fusty bedroom filled with trash
paint on the floor 
and 
jars filled with ash
Bowie on repeat and Alice on the walls
remembering days 
as our good times rolled

late morning sleep ins
the house is empty
gate crashing losers
getting it on plenty
Bowie on repeat and Alice on the walls
feeling the world at our feet
as rainbows soared

out in the night
past the owls and the horse
stumbling through hay barns
as the music roared 
Bowie on repeat and Alice on the walls
pitch black fumbling
ripped lace then nothing at all.
